This Year's Model Updates:

For 2011, the Buick LaCrosse discontinues the 3.0-liter V6 and gains six free months of OnStar's Directions and Connections plan. Also, the four-cylinder model gets a new electric-assist power steering system.

Pros:
  • Elegant interior styling
  • Smooth and quiet ride
  • Available all-wheel drive.
  • Admirable driving dynamics
  • Good performance from V6 models
Cons:
  • Underpowered four-cylinder engine
  • Limited luggage space.
  • Lack of rearward visibility

  • LaCrosse: American Company, Global Design - 2011 Buick LaCrosse
    By -

    All in all This is one of the most uniquely-designed cars I have ever owned. Of course its a GM product, but its also an amalgamation of engineering and design elements from Germany, Asia, as well as America. You would think that this would make for an odd combination, but all the elements really work well together. I bought the CX model with the V-6 and comfort convenience package for 26K which included a credit union discount and a loyalty discount - a great value for a refined, smooth riding, performance (280hp) car. The CX has cloth seats and I really recommend giving the cloth a look before springing for the leather on the CXL or CXS. The cloth is very comfortable and luxurious.

  • Almost Perfect - 2011 Buick LaCrosse
    By -

    My first time on the road with this car had me sold. I researched for over 2 months before making my purchase and I am very glad that I did. The interior is amazingly designed. While some of the reviews for 10-11 lacrosse are stating that the dash is too cluttered with buttons, I find no problem at all finding what I need (Most of the time its on the steering wheel if you should be playing with it in motion). Exterior design is great as well. Beautiful lines. The trunk line is a little high making visibility a minor issue but thanks to reverse sensing system I think its a wash. A Pillars are a little thick but its not out of hand. Very quiet ride, smooth, yet responsive in its handling.
